site stats

Radix sort in ds

WebRadix sort is a sorting technique that sorts the elements by first grouping the individual digits of the same place value. Then, sort the elements according to their … WebThere is a different radix sort algorithm which uses the same basic pass routine but sorts on the most significant digit first: Sort on digit position `dig'. Sort (recursively) each of the …

Radix Sort - Monash University

WebRadix sort is an algorithm that uses counting sort as a subroutine to sort an array of integers/strings in either ascending or descending order. The main idea of radix sort … WebWe write 6 different sorting algorithms: Bubble, Selection, Insertion, Quick, Merge, and Radix Sort. Then, we switch gears and implement our own data structures from scratch, including linked lists, trees, heaps, hash tables, and graphs . We learn to traverse trees and graphs, and cover Dijkstra's Shortest Path Algorithm . shipwrecked where is stone cutter https://lerestomedieval.com

Design and Analysis Radix Sort - Tutorialspoint

Web2. sort(a, beg, j-1) 3. sort (a, j+1, end) 2. else 1. return Complexity of quick sort algorithm: Assume that array size n is power of 2 Let n = 2m , so that m = log 2 n Assume that proper … http://letsmastercs.com/tutorials/data-structures/ds-radix-sort.php WebRadix Animation by Y. Daniel Liang Usage: Perform radix sort for a list of 15 random integers from 0 to 999. Click the Step button to move a number to a bucket. Click the Reset button to start over with a new random list. StepReset quick reading assessment middle school

Quick Sort - javatpoint

Category:Radix Sort - Monash University

Tags:Radix sort in ds

Radix sort in ds

Radix sort - Wikipedia

WebRadix sort is the linear sorting algorithm that is used for integers. In Radix sort, there is digit by digit sorting is performed that is started from the least significant digit to the most … WebRadix sort is a small method that many people intuitively use when alphabetizing a large list of names. Specifically, the list of names is first sorted according to the first letter of each …

Radix sort in ds

Did you know?

WebPlease like & share this video and subscribe to my YouTube channel WebNov 9, 2010 · Radix sort isn't a comparison-based sort and can only sort numeric types like integers (including pointer addresses) and floating-point, and it's a bit difficult to portably …

WebThe sorting algorithm which is very well suited for parallelization is radix sort. It represents non-comparison based sorts [12] with the low computational complexity of O(N), where N is the number of elements to sort. Keys to be sorted are viewed as sequences of fixed-sized pieces, e.g., decimal numbers are

Following are some advantages of the radix sorting algorithm: 1. Fast when the keys are short, i.e. when the array element range is small. 2. Used in suffix arrays construction … See more After understanding the pseudocode of the radix sort algorithm, you will now examine its performance in this tutorial. See more WebDec 21, 2015 · 1. Radix sort is all about sorting binary numbers. Luckily for us, integers are binary numbers too (amongst the best binary numbers actually). Another advantage of using the binary form is that we can group on 10 bits instead of 8 bits if we want. For example, for numbers ranging from 0 - 1000000, 2 x 10 bits could be used for grouping/sorting.

WebFeb 12, 2024 · 3. Key points for radix sort algorithm. Radix Sort is a linear sorting algorithm.; The time complexity of Radix Sort is O(nd), where n is the size of the array and d is the number of digits in the largest number. It is not an in-place sorting algorithm as it requires extra additional space.; Radix Sort is a stable sort as the relative order of elements with …

WebRadix Sort. By Eric Suh. Radix Sort is a clever and intuitive little sorting algorithm. Radix Sort puts the elements in order by comparing the digits of the numbers. I will explain with an … quick reading synonymWebRadix sort is a non-comparison-based sorting algorithm. The word radix, by definition, refers to the base or the number of unique digits used to represent numbers. In radix sort, we sort the elements by processing them in multiple passes, digit by digit. shipwrecked wikiWebSorting is a very classic problem of reordering items (that can be compared, e.g., integers, floating-point numbers, strings, etc) of an array (or a list) in a certain order (increasing, non-decreasing (increasing or flat), decreasing, non-increasing (decreasing or flat), lexicographical, etc).There are many different sorting algorithms, each has its own … shipwrecked walkthroughWebFeb 14, 2024 · The selection sort algorithm is as follows: Step 1: Set Min to location 0 in Step 1. Step 2: Look for the smallest element on the list. Step 3: Replace the value at location Min with a different value. Step 4: Increase Min to point to the next element Step 5: Continue until the list is sorted. Pseudocode of Selection Sort Algorithm quick readyshareWebRadix sort works by sorting each digit from least significant digit to most significant digit. So in base 10 (the decimal system), radix sort would sort by the digits in the 1's place, then … shipwrecked wineWebO ( w + n ) {\displaystyle O (w+n)} In computer science, radix sort is a non- comparative sorting algorithm. It avoids comparison by creating and distributing elements into buckets according to their radix. For elements with more than one significant digit, this bucketing process is repeated for each digit, while preserving the ordering of the ... quick read food thermometerWebRadix sort is a small method that many people intuitively use when alphabetizing a large list of names. Specifically, the list of names is first sorted according to the first letter of each name, that is, the names are arranged in 26 classes. Intuitively, one might want to sort numbers on their most significant digit. shipwrecked with someone